Why Traditional Email Marketing Is Failing

The industry average open rate has stagnated at 21%, meaning that 4 out of every 5 emails are ignored—this is not only a waste of resources but also a chronic erosion of brand trust. A leading e-commerce platform once sent maternity products in the early morning based on a rough segmentation of “past purchases,” resulting in an open rate of less than 9% among target users and a threefold increase in complaints. The core issue isn’t the channel’s failure; it’s that strategies still operate in the “wide-net” era, lacking deep insights into user behavior patterns, content preferences, and lifecycle stages.

The traditional model of treating users as static labels is doomed to fail. Real-world data shows that email opens are highly dependent on sending time, device type, and recent engagement levels. Ignoring these dynamic signals is tantamount to voluntarily giving up the battle for attention. Identifying Key Behavioral Patterns That Influence Open Rates

Do you think send time determines the open rate? The real key lies in the predictability of user behavior patterns. When 90% of marketing emails are ignored, the problem isn’t content quality—it’s whether you’re reaching the right people at the moment they’re most likely to act. A SaaS company used clustering analysis of timestamps, device types, and geographic locations to identify the “golden open window” for high-intent users, boosting their open rate by 37%.

After integrating CRM and email platform APIs to build a unified customer view, we found that only 18% of the “active minority” accounts for 68% of all interactions. This means that broad-based mass emailing is wasting resources. Behavioral stratification allows you to optimize sending rhythms for high-frequency users, since precision operations must be based on dynamic segmentation, while designing wake-up mechanisms for low-frequency groups can significantly reduce ineffective outreach costs, often cutting wasted sends by more than 30%.

Building a Dynamic Content Delivery Mechanism

Once you’ve identified key behavioral patterns, the real challenge begins: how do you deliver the right content to each user in real time and with pinpoint accuracy? The answer lies in a machine-learning-driven dynamic content delivery mechanism—it’s not just the core technical path for improving relevance; it’s the engine that turns data insights into business returns.

By training models to predict individual users’ open probabilities, the system can automatically optimize send times and subject line combinations. For example, an e-commerce platform replaced traditional A/B testing with a multi-armed bandit algorithm, locking in the optimal send time within two weeks, increasing the open rate by 27% while reducing manual trial-and-error costs by 60%. This continuous learning mechanism means that every touchpoint is smarter than the last, as the system keeps evolving.

Start Your Data Optimization Plan

You don’t need to wait for a perfect system to start optimizing your email data—just five immediately actionable steps: clean historical data, build a metrics dashboard, define user segments, deploy an automation engine, and conduct continuous A/B testing. Each step corresponds to a common pitfall—for example, failing to remove invalid subscriptions can introduce sample bias, misleading you about the true meaning of a high open rate.

Start by cleaning three years’ worth of email logs, removing hard bounces, bot traffic, and inactive accounts. A B2C brand discovered that this reduced the apparent open rate by 40% but increased the conversion rate by 22%, because the audience became more targeted. Build a real-time dashboard focusing on behavioral metrics like “first open duration” and “second-click interval,” which helps you quickly identify high-value users, since response speed is often a strong signal of purchase intent. We recommend using the RFM model to segment users and avoid one-size-fits-all messaging; then use a rules engine to enable dynamic outreach within 72 hours after opening, which tests show increases re-engagement rates by 35%.
